学习编程需要学习什么专业

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要学习编程,首先需要学习计算机科学专业。计算机科学是研究计算机技术原理和方法的学科,涉及计算机硬件、软件、算法、数据结构、操作系统、网络等方面的知识。学习计算机科学可以掌握编程基础,理解计算机系统的工作原理,培养解决问题的能力。

    在计算机科学的基础上,可以进一步学习软件工程专业。软件工程是指将计算机科学原理与工程原理相结合,以提高软件的质量、效率、可维护性和可靠性。学习软件工程可以学习到软件开发的各个环节,包括需求分析、设计、编码、测试、维护等。同时也可以学习到软件项目管理、软件质量保证等相关知识。

    此外,学习编程还可以选择专门的编程语言专业。编程语言专业主要是研究各种编程语言的特点、语法、用途等。学习编程语言可以帮助开发者更深入地理解编程,并熟练掌握不同编程语言的使用。

    除了上述专业,还可以学习相关的数学知识,如离散数学、算法与数据结构、数值计算等。这些数学知识对于编程算法的设计与分析非常重要。

    综上所述,学习编程需要学习计算机科学专业、软件工程专业、编程语言专业以及相关的数学知识。通过系统学习这些专业知识,才能够全面理解编程,并具备开发高质量软件的能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习编程并不要求学习特定的专业,但以下专业可能对学习编程有帮助:

    1. 计算机科学:计算机科学是最直接与编程相关的专业之一。在计算机科学学位课程中,学生将学习编程的基本概念、算法、数据结构和软件开发等知识,为他们建立编程的坚实基础。

    2. 软件工程:软件工程专业着重于软件开发的实践和技术。学生将学习如何分析、设计、测试和维护软件系统。软件工程的课程将包括编程、软件质量保证和项目管理等方面的内容。

    3. 数学:数学作为一门抽象思维的学科,对编程的逻辑思维和问题求解能力有很大帮助。数学专业的课程将培养学生的逻辑思维和抽象能力,这在编程中是十分重要的。

    4. 信息技术管理:信息技术管理专业注重于组织和管理信息技术系统。学生将学习如何选择、实施和管理IT解决方案。尽管这不是一个编程专业,但学习信息技术管理可以帮助学生了解如何将编程应用于实际业务中。

    5. 电子工程:电子工程专业涉及到硬件和嵌入式系统的设计与开发,这在某些情况下需要编程的能力。学习电子工程可以帮助学生了解硬件和软件之间的交互,以及如何编写嵌入式系统的代码。

    此外,还可以通过自学学习编程,无需特定的专业。互联网上有许多免费和付费的编程学习资源,包括在线课程、教程和编程社区等。只要有足够的兴趣和动力,任何人都可以学习编程,并且取得较好的进展。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习编程可以选择多个专业进行学习,以下是一些与编程相关的专业:

    1. 计算机科学:这是最常见的与编程相关的专业。学习计算机科学可以掌握编程语言、算法、数据结构等基本知识,同时也可以学习操作系统、数据库、网络等与编程密切相关的知识。

    2. 软件工程:软件工程专注于软件开发的整个过程,学习该专业可以了解软件项目管理、软件质量保证、软件测试等方面的知识,对于编程的实践能力也有一定的强调。

    3. 信息技术:信息技术专注于计算机系统的应用和管理,学习该专业可以了解计算机系统、网络技术、信息安全等领域的知识,对于编程的应用能力有很大的帮助。

    4. 数据科学与人工智能:这是近年来兴起的热门专业,学习该专业可以学习机器学习、数据分析等与编程相关的知识,可以在大数据和人工智能领域进行深入研究和应用。

    5. 数学或统计学:数学和统计学是编程中基础的学科,学习这些学科可以帮助理解和应用编程中的算法和逻辑。

    除了以上几个专业,还有一些与编程相关的专业如网络工程、计算机图形学、嵌入式系统等。此外,一些学校还设有专门的软件工程、移动应用开发、前端开发等与编程领域有关的专业。选择学习哪个专业取决于个人兴趣和未来的职业发展方向。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部